REVISED SCHEDULE FOR KUMHO FIA TCR WORLD TOUR AT THE BEND
Due to global shipping delays impacting the arrival of international freight into Australia, the schedule for this weekend’s Kumho FIA TCR World Tour round has been revised.
The event will move from a three-race format to two races of approximately 60km each, as run at the championship’s previous two rounds in Italy and Portugal.
With the international Kumho FIA TCR World Tour cars and equipment now set to arrive on circuit on Friday, practice has been consolidated to a single 30-minute session, to be held at 7:15am (ACST) on Saturday.
Qualifying will take place at 9:00am ACST on Saturday, with a 30-minute format (20 minutes for the full field in Q1, and 10 minutes for the top 12 in Q2) remaining unchanged from the original schedule.
The opening race of the weekend will take place at 2:15pm ACST on Saturday, with Race 2 scheduled for 12:00pm ACST on Sunday.
Qualifying and both races will be televised live in Australia on Fox Sports and Kayo.
